WebMar 13, 2024 · In the absolute scales required by the ideal gas law, standard atmospheric pressure is 14.7 psi and standard temperature is 528 degrees Rankine, which equals 68 degrees Fahrenheit. Using these values, we obtain: SCFM = ACFM (P A /14.7 psi) (528˚R/T A) ACFM = SCFM (14.7 psi/P A) (T A /528˚R) Accounting for Humidity WebInside duct diameter is the most important measurement, but an outside measurement is often sufficient for a sheet metal duct. WebFeb 14, 2024 · Standard Cubic Feet per Minute (SCFM) is the flow rate of a gas or air through a compressor at standard temperature and pressure conditions. The standard temperature for calculating SCFM flow rate ranges from 60°F to 68°F, at a pressure of 14.7 psi and relative humidity of 36%.
